What is an Ad Account Suspension?
An ad account suspension is a platform-side restriction that blocks an advertiser from spending. Suspensions range from a temporary disable for a single creative to a permanent business-level ban that propagates across every related account, payment method, and domain.
Why accounts get suspended
The biggest causes: policy violations on landing pages, abrupt spend jumps, payment method failures, mismatched business verification, and creative claims that fail Google's or Meta's automated review. Repeat offenses escalate quickly into permanent bans.
Tiers of suspension
Disabled (one account), business manager disabled (all accounts in that BM), payment-instrument flag (any account using that card), and circumvention ban (every account ever linked by IP, browser fingerprint, or contact data).
Appeal vs. start fresh
First disable: appeal within 24 hours with corrected landing pages. Second disable on the same business: appeal once, then plan a full migration. Permanent ban: do not retry from the same network or device. Move to clean infrastructure.

Frequently asked
How fast can a suspended account be appealed?
First appeal usually resolves in 24 to 72 hours on agency-tier accounts. Self-serve can take weeks.
Will the platform refund my balance?
Verified balances are refunded if the suspension is overturned. Permanent bans typically forfeit pending balances.
Can I use the same business name on a new account?
If the original suspension was creative-specific, yes. If the business itself was banned, no, that name will trip the same flag.

Practical implementation
To avoid ad account suspensions, ensure compliance with platform policies by regularly reviewing landing pages for adherence and confirming that verification documents match the provided business details. Additionally, monitor spending patterns to avoid abrupt changes that may raise flags with the advertising platforms.
